What Is ASHP's Membership Term?
ASHP memberships are based on a rolling membership term. Your membership begins on the date you join and remains active through the end of the corresponding month one year later.
Membership renewal date is based on individual membership start date. Members enrolled in Annual Auto-Renewal and the Monthly Payment Plan will have their membership renewed automatically each year using the payment method on file.

2026 Membership Rates
| Membership Categories | Description | Membership Dues |
| Practicing Pharmacist | Pharmacists licensed to practice in the United States or its territories more than 2 years removed from graduation and not participating in a residency or fellowship | $375 |
| Supporting Associate* | Non-pharmacists who support ASHP’s mission |
$375 |
| International Associate* | Pharmacists and non-pharmacists interested in pharmacy who reside outside the United States. | $375 |
| Joint Member/Spouse | One spouse pays full member dues; the other pays a reduced rate. | $553 ($375+$188) |
| Technician* | Includes subscriptions to PharmacyTech CE and AJHP |
$60 |
| Retired | Previous Active Full Members age 65 and older | $188 |
| New Practitioner | First year post graduate members and individuals participating in a post graduate year one or two residency or fellowship | $94 |
| New Practitioner | Second year post graduate members not participating in a residency or fellowship | $188 |
| Student P1* | Individuals enrolled in a full-time undergraduate or graduate pharmacy program in an accredited U.S. college of pharmacy | $0 |
| Student P2-P4* | Individuals enrolled in a full-time undergraduate or graduate pharmacy program in an accredited U.S. college of pharmacy | $60 |
* Non-voting membership categories
